Increasing Network Throughput by Integrating Protocol Layers

被引:40
作者
Abbott, Mark B. [1 ]
Peterson, Larry L. [2 ]
机构
[1] Penn State Univ, Dept Comp Sci & Engn, University Pk, PA 16802 USA
[2] Univ Arizona, Dept Comp Sci, Tucson, AZ 85721 USA
关键词
D O I
10.1109/90.251918
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Integrating protocol data manipulations is a strategy for increasing the throughput of network protocols. The idea is to combine a series of protocol layers into a pipeline so as to access message data more efficiently. This paper introduces a widely-applicable technique for integrating protocols. This technique not only improves performance, but also preserves the modularity of protocol layers by automatically integrating independently expressed protocols. The paper also describes a prototype integration tool, and studies the performance limits and scalability of protocol integration.
引用
收藏
页码:600 / 610
页数:11
相关论文
共 10 条
[1]  
ABBOTT MB, 1993, IEEE ACM T NETWORKIN, V1
[2]  
ABBOTT MB, 1993, THESIS U ARIZONA
[3]  
Clark D. D., 1990, P ACM S COMM ARCH PR, P200
[4]   AN ANALYSIS OF TCP PROCESSING OVERHEAD [J].
CLARK, DD ;
JACOBSON, V ;
ROMKEY, J ;
SALWEN, H .
IEEE COMMUNICATIONS MAGAZINE, 1989, 27 (06) :23-29
[5]  
DRUSCHEL P, 1993, IEEE NETWORK JUL, P8
[6]  
GUNNINGBERG P, 1991, P 2 MULTIG WORKSH
[7]  
KERNIGHAN BW, 1986, UNIX PROGRAMMERS SUP, V1
[8]  
Mogul J., 1987, SOSP, P39
[9]   A DYNAMIC NETWORK ARCHITECTURE [J].
OMALLEY, SW ;
PETERSON, LL .
ACM TRANSACTIONS ON COMPUTER SYSTEMS, 1992, 10 (02) :110-143
[10]  
TURNER CJ, 1992, P SIGCOMM S COMM ARC, P258